Spell is a framework that provides necessary tooling to create highly customisable,
shells for your wayland compositors (like hyprland) using Slint UI.

Rather then leveraging Gtk for widget creation, Slint declarative language provides
a very easy but comprehensive way to make aesthetic interfaces. It, supports rust
as backend, so as though there are not many batteries (for now) included
in the framework itself, everything can be brought to life from the dark arts of
rust.

## Why Slint? :thinking:

Slint because it is a simple yet powerful declarative lang that is extremely
easy to learn (you can even get a sense in just few mins [here](https://docs.slint.dev/latest/docs/slint/guide/language/concepts/slint-language/)). Secondly, unlike
other good UI kits, it just has awesome integration for rust. A compatibility that
is hard to find.

## Minimal Example :sparkles:

I am creating my own shell from spell, which is currently private and will soon be shown
on display as spell becomes more mature. As for producing a minimal example, you can clone
[slint-rust-template](https://github.com/slint-ui/slint-rust-template/blob/main/src/main.rs) and change the name to your preferred name ( don't forget to modify `Cargo.toml`).Then add spell in dependencies
from this github link along with the following patches in the bottom.

```toml
[patch.crates-io]
slint = { git = "https://github.com/slint-ui/slint" }
slint-build = { git = "https://github.com/slint-ui/slint" }
i-slint-core = { git = "https://github.com/slint-ui/slint" }
i-slint-renderer-skia = { git = "https://github.com/slint-ui/slint" }
```

and then replace `main.rs` with following contents:

```rust
use std::{ env, error::Error};
use slint::ComponentHandle;
use spell_framework::{
    cast_spell,
    layer_properties::{BoardType, LayerAnchor, LayerType, WindowConf},
    wayland_adapter::SpellWin,
};
slint::include_modules!();

fn main() -> Result<(), Box<dyn Error>> {
    let window_conf = WindowConf::new(
        376,
        576,
        (Some(LayerAnchor::TOP), Some(LayerAnchor::LEFT)),
        (5, 0, 0, 10),
        LayerType::Top,
        BoardType::None,
        None,
    );

    let waywindow = SpellWin::invoke_spell("counter-widget", window_conf);
    let ui = AppWindow::new().unwrap();
    ui.on_request_increase_value({
        let ui_handle = ui.as_weak();
        move || {
            let ui = ui_handle.unwrap();
            ui.set_counter(ui.get_counter() + 1);
        }
    });
    cast_spell(waywindow, None, None)
}
```

## Batteries :battery:

Not a lot of batteries included for now, future implementations of common functionalities will occur
in `vault` module of this crate. For now it has a AppSelector, which can be used to retrieve app information
for creating a launcher. Other common functionalities like system tray, temp etc, will be added later for
convenience. I recommend the use of following crates for some basic usage, though you must note
that I haven't used them extensively myself (for now). For roadmap, view [here](https://github.com/VimYoung/Spell/blob/main/ROADMAP.md).

1. [sysinfo]https://crates.io/crates/sysinfo: For System info like uptime, cpu, memory usage etc.
2. [rusty-network-manger]https://crates.io/crates/rusty_network_manager: For network management.
3. [bluer]https://docs.rs/bluer/latest/bluer/: For bluetooth management.
